  • Patent number: 5816249
    Abstract: A procedure for the manufacturing of an improved condom features a knitted fabric adhered to the condom. The fabric is deformed in a longitudinal sense in relation to its axle, by means of a system through which the fabric, in the shape of a tube, is introduced into a cone. Two parallel conveyor bands with fastening devices are adhered to the fabric. Once the fabric is cut through in the middle of both bands, it is conveniently guided onto the condom matrixes where elastomeric rings deform and fit it tight. The whole set thus obtained is ready to be dipped into an adhesive coating and later dried after which drying, electrically heated metallic rings cut away the remainder of the fabric that failed to adhere to the condom. Thus the latter is rolled and readied for packaging.

  • Patent number: 5769614
    Abstract: A high-pressure pump having a high-pressure cylinder which has a vertically moving plunger fitted therein from the upper side thereof. The high-pressure cylinder has at least one opening in the bottommost portion thereof to allow a fluid to flow in or out of the high-pressure cylinder. A hydraulic cylinder for driving the plunger is provided on the top of the high-pressure cylinder. In addition, a migration preventing device is provided between the hydraulic cylinder and the high-pressure cylinder and in contact with the plunger driving shaft to prevent migration of a working fluid leaking out from the hydraulic cylinder to the surface of the plunger fitted in the high-pressure cylinder.

  • Patent number: 5662214
    Abstract: A package for dispensing one or more condoms directly on a penis. The package consists of a flexible container having the general configuration of a penis with a first leak proof layer inside with the open end of the layer stretched over the outside of the container. The layer has a strip for proving penetration or unsealing. The condom is located within the layer and the open end is rolled over the outside of the container and the leak proof layer. A second leak proof layer lines the inside of the condom with the open end rolled over the first leak proof layer and the condom. To dispense the condom on a penis, the penis is inserted and the strip is pulled to unseal the condom from the first layer, permitting the penis to be removed from the container.

  • Patent number: 5622613
    Abstract: The present invention provides a method for manufacturing hypochlorite efficiently, using an anode, which has a coating containing palladium oxide by 10 to 45 weight %, ruthenium oxide by 15 to 45 weight %, titanium dioxide by 10 to 40 weight %, and platinum by 10 to 20 weight % as well as an oxide of at least one metal selected from cobalt, lanthanum, cerium or yttrium by 2 to 10 weight % being formed on a conductive base, and a cathode comprising a coating having low hydrogen overvoltage and covered with a reduction preventive film and being formed on a conductive base, and an aqueous solution of a chloride is electrolyzed without a diaphragm.
